Samsung's latest flagship phone is out, and the fight is on. Can the Samsung Galaxy S9 take on the iPhone X? Mark Spoonauer, Editor-In-Chief at Tom's Guide, gives Cheddar at first look at the new phone and shares his take.
The S9 features an updated camera with new front-facing features. Spoonauer shows hosts Baker Machado and Brad Smith how to use the camera's hottest new features, such as improved slow motion and animated emojis.

A Minnesota utility began shutting down a nuclear power plant near Minneapolis on Friday after discovering water containing a low level of radioactive material was leaking from a pipe for the second time. While the utility and health officials say it is not dangerous, the issue has prompted concerns among nearby residents and raised questions about aging pipelines.
